Player Psychology: Its Influence on Decision-Making

Understanding the mental processes behind player choices is crucial for optimizing outcomes in any chance-based game. Cognitive biases, emotional states, and individual beliefs play significant roles in how participants interact with risk and reward scenarios.

One prevalent phenomenon is loss aversion, where individuals exhibit a stronger emotional response to losses than to equivalent gains. This can lead players to avoid risks that could otherwise be beneficial, causing them to miss out on potential opportunities. Recognizing this tendency allows for more measured risk-taking, adjusting strategies to embrace calculated risks rather than instinctive withdrawals.

An essential aspect of player behavior is the concept of the gambler’s fallacy, wherein participants believe that past events can influence future outcomes. For instance, after a series of losses, a player might erroneously assume that a win is “due.” Awareness of this trap can foster a more rational approach, focusing on probabilities rather than perceived patterns.

Emotional triggers also significantly affect decision-making. Stress, excitement, or frustration can impair judgment and lead to impulsive actions. It’s vital to cultivate a mental state conducive to sound choices; techniques such as mindfulness or brief breaks during gameplay can mitigate negative emotional impacts and enhance overall performance.

The role of individual risk tolerance varies widely from person to person. Some thrive on high-stakes environments, while others prefer a more conservative approach. Participants should assess their comfort levels and align their actions accordingly, ensuring that choices reflect personal styles and preferences rather than external pressures or perceived norms.
